Certified Registered Nurse Anesthetist:
We have a Full-Time Certified Registered Nurse Anesthetist opportunity at Weeks Medical Center. This is an opportunity for excellent work-life balance, and competitive compensation including a base salary, pager rate, callback pay, and benefits package. Commencement Relocation.:

Join two CRNAs and one physician in a position that offers an excellent work-life balance with 17 weeks off per year. Practice all aspects of anesthesia independently. Our CRNAs provide general anesthesia, regional anesthesia, and sedation in our 2 operating rooms and a procedure room. We provide airway management services to our emergency department and our intensive care unit. We offer acute pain services including ultrasound-guided peripheral nerve blocks and post-operative epidural management for our surgical patients. Anesthesia provides services for various specialties which include Gastroenterology, General Surgery, Orthopedic Surgery, Podiatry, and Urology.:

A typical day at Weeks Medical Center begins with a 0800 first start case, with elective cases ending by 1530. Assignments are made daily by the Medical Director. Once cases have been completed, our CRNAs may take call from home.:

All CRNAs are categorized as Medical Staff. As such they have voting rights and are encouraged to be active members of our Medical staff on various committees.:

About WMC:
The major strength of Weeks Medical Center is found in the ability of our physicians and staff to offer extensive services utilizing state-of-the-art technology while maintaining personalized care of a community hospital. Weeks is a 25-bed critical access hospital offering medical, surgical, and intensive care services. In addition, a wide variety of outpatient services are available, including cardiac and physical rehabilitation; a fully-staffed oncology department; 24-hour emergency care; a fully equipped laboratory; and an extensive radiology department. About North Country Healthcare (NHC):
North Country Healthcare is a non-profit affiliation of four medical facilities in the White Mountains Region of New Hampshire. NCH includes numerous physicians and medical providers at multiple locations. This leading comprehensive healthcare network which employs hundreds of highly-trained individuals delivers integrated patient care through three community hospitals, specialty clinics, and home health and hospice services. NCH remains committed to the health and well-being of the communities we serve.

Member organizations include Androscoggin Valley Hospital in Berlin, Upper Connecticut Valley Hospital in Colebrook, Weeks Medical Center in Lancaster, and North Country Home Health and Hospice Agency in Littleton. NCH is proud to be the largest employer in the North Country.
